Kajabi vs. Thinkific vs. Teachable (2026 Edition)

2026 Platform Comparison: Which Delivers the Most Business Value?

When creators compare platforms, they often focus on monthly price, but the real differentiator is how many tools you need outside the platform to actually sell, market, and scale.

This comparison looks at total business capability, not just course hosting.

 

Kajabi vs Thinkific vs Teachable


Feature and Value Comparison (2026)

Category Kajabi Thinkific Teachable
Platform Positioning All in one business platform Course platform Course platform
Core Focus Selling, marketing, scaling Course delivery Course delivery
Built In Email Marketing Yes full system Limited Limited
Marketing Automation Advanced workflows Minimal Minimal
Sales Funnels Native and unlimited Requires tools Limited
CRM and Tagging Built in Basic Basic
Landing Pages Unlimited Basic Basic
Affiliate Management Built in Basic Basic
Community Native and integrated Available Available
Transaction Fees None None Yes on entry plans
Need for External Tools Low Moderate to high Moderate to high
Scalability Without Tool Sprawl High Medium Low
Overall Business Readiness Highest Medium Low

 

Why Kajabi Wins in 2026

1. Kajabi Is Not Just a Course Platform

Thinkific and Teachable are strong course delivery systems.
Kajabi is a business operating system.

👉👉In 2026, creators are not just uploading courses. They are:

  • Running launches

  • Building email lists

  • Segmenting audiences

  • Automating sales

  • Managing communities

  • Testing offers

Kajabi supports all of that without requiring a separate tech stack.

 

2. Lower “True Cost” Despite Higher Sticker Price

While Kajabi’s monthly price is higher, it often replaces:

  • An email marketing platform

  • A funnel builder

  • A CRM

  • An automation tool

  • Affiliate software

When those costs are combined, Kajabi frequently becomes less expensive overall than running Thinkific or Teachable plus multiple integrations.

This is where Kajabi consistently outperforms competitors on total cost of ownership.

 

3. Built for Scaling, Not Just Hosting

In 2026, the biggest limitation creators hit is not course limits, it’s systems.

Kajabi’s advantage is that:

  • Marketing tools scale with the business

  • Automation grows with complexity

  • Teams can collaborate inside one platform

  • Data stays centralized

That makes Kajabi the stronger long term choice for creators who intend to build a business, not just sell a single course.

 

2026 Verdict: Best Platform by Use Case

🏆 Best Overall Platform for Business Builders

Kajabi
Best choice for creators who want to sell, market, automate, and scale without stitching together multiple tools.

🥈 Best Course Delivery Platform

Thinkific
Strong for creators focused primarily on course content who are comfortable using external tools for marketing.

🥉 Best Entry Level Experiment Platform

Teachable
Lowest barrier to entry, but transaction fees and limited automation reduce long term value.
